## Who to ping about GiftNote

Welcome aboard! GiftNote is our donation-receipt mailer for the Larchfield Fund. Template tweaks go to the comms folks; delivery failures and bounce weirdness go to the platform crew. Don't push template changes on Fridays — receipts batch over the weekend. For anything GiftNote-related, start with the address below.

billing contact of kaweg-tajeg = drudor.lamion.oliath@torvalabs.test

**Handover: Retention Sweeper (Marrowby)**

The Marrowby data-retention sweeper is mid-migration to the new policy schema. It's paused on purpose — do not resume until the dry-run report lands. If it pages overnight, check the quarantine bucket first; deletions are reversible for 72 hours. Admin access to the sweeper console requires unlocking the ops keystore with the recovery passphrase below.

unlock words, hahip-baduf: holwyn-istath-julvan

## Step 4: Configure spoolerd

Pull the `spoolerd` image, mount `/var/spool/fernwick`, and set `SPOOLERD_PORT=7410` plus `SPOOLERD_QUEUE_MAX=500` in the env file. Health check is `GET /ping`. Restart with `fernctl restart spoolerd` after edits. The queue broker's auth secret must be added as the very next line.

env line for fafof-fahag: LEDGER_TOKEN5=f8790